From 0c82c162935a874d9e4648dbdf3d6ad015743156 Mon Sep 17 00:00:00 2001 From: PhyoTheingi Date: Fri, 2 Jun 2017 11:38:46 +0630 Subject: [PATCH] Order Queue Station Bug Fix --- .../settings/order_queue_stations_controller.rb | 6 +++--- .../settings/order_queue_stations/edit.html.erb | 16 ++++++++++++---- .../settings/order_queue_stations/show.html.erb | 8 ++++++++ 3 files changed, 23 insertions(+), 7 deletions(-) diff --git a/app/controllers/settings/order_queue_stations_controller.rb b/app/controllers/settings/order_queue_stations_controller.rb index ec85e56a..e0cf0d08 100644 --- a/app/controllers/settings/order_queue_stations_controller.rb +++ b/app/controllers/settings/order_queue_stations_controller.rb @@ -1,5 +1,5 @@ class Settings::OrderQueueStationsController < ApplicationController - before_action :set_settings_order_queue_station, only: [:show, :edit,:new, :update, :destroy] + before_action :set_settings_order_queue_station, only: [:show, :edit, :update, :destroy] # GET /settings/order_queue_stations # GET /settings/order_queue_stations.json @@ -25,10 +25,10 @@ class Settings::OrderQueueStationsController < ApplicationController # POST /settings/order_queue_stations.json def create @settings_order_queue_station = OrderQueueStation.new(settings_order_queue_station_params) - + @settings_order_queue_station.created_by = current_login_employee.name respond_to do |format| if @settings_order_queue_station.save - format.html { redirect_to @settings_order_queue_station, notice: 'Order queue station was successfully created.' } + format.html { redirect_to settings_order_queue_stations_path, notice: 'Order queue station was successfully created.' } format.json { render :show, status: :created, location: @settings_order_queue_station } else format.html { render :new } diff --git a/app/views/settings/order_queue_stations/edit.html.erb b/app/views/settings/order_queue_stations/edit.html.erb index af08ffda..27cf2fc8 100644 --- a/app/views/settings/order_queue_stations/edit.html.erb +++ b/app/views/settings/order_queue_stations/edit.html.erb @@ -1,6 +1,14 @@ -

Editing Settings Order Queue Station

+ -<%= link_to 'Show', @settings_order_queue_station %> | -<%= link_to 'Back', settings_order_queue_stations_path %> +
+ + <%= render 'form', settings_order_queue_station: @settings_order_queue_station %> +
\ No newline at end of file diff --git a/app/views/settings/order_queue_stations/show.html.erb b/app/views/settings/order_queue_stations/show.html.erb index 00004528..1a80c2c0 100644 --- a/app/views/settings/order_queue_stations/show.html.erb +++ b/app/views/settings/order_queue_stations/show.html.erb @@ -1,3 +1,11 @@ + +

<%= notice %>